Apple's Sales organization generates the revenue needed to fuel our ongoing development of products and services. This in turn, enriches the lives of hundreds of millions of people around the world. As part of our Business Operations team, you will be responsible for supporting sales teams to deliver Apple technology to consumer partners.
In this role, you will work closely with sales, supply chain, reseller operations and finance teams to analyze business performance, understand market dynamics, provide insights on this performance to leadership, identify weekly opportunities and playbook(s) of actions to be driven across the team. You will set quotas for the sales team and reseller incentive programs in partnership with finance team and measure performance against the targets. You will be responsible for driving special projects cross functionally that impact our business in the short and long term. You will help drive the preparation of weekly reviews/materials to assess performance of business, monitor/analyze daily/weekly performance, help identify opportunities and insights to improve performance, and drive execution across teams to achieve the forecast/goal. You will collaborate with engineers and data scientists to identify use cases for AI/ML that can provide valuable insights and drive business growth.
Responsibilities
- Own business performance analysis for certain lines of business - identifying variances, defining causes, specifying potential actions and their impact
- Lead cross-functional team that dives deep across a range of factors (micro + macro) influencing the performance of certain lines of businesses
- Lead US Leadership team's preparation for bi-weekly Sales Review with C-suite leadership and other reporting in key seasonal moments / new product launches
- Analyze sales performance for sales leadership; highlight implications and suggest actions for improvement
- Engage in allocation and supply analytics by collaborating with supply chain, finance, and sales teams
- Lead cross functional team for managing excess inventory
- Support forecast calls, evaluation of inventory needs, etc.
- Provide analytics to manage trade-offs in times of product constraint (within business, across the U.S.)
- Serve as a business owner to internal AI/ML engineering and data science teams helping drive forward the vision for internal systems and tools driving business automation
